Former PH president Rodrigo Duterte is now in The Hague after arrest, and his good friend Manny Villar hopes for a fair trial for him.

On March 12, 2025, the International Criminal Court (ICC) confirmed that former PH president Rodrigo Duterte had surrendered to their custody. The ICC released the arrest warrant, and this was served by the PH authorities.

Rodrigo Duterte

Duterte arrived at The Hague on Wednesday night, and shortly after, he was put under the ICC’s custody. He is now in detention for charges of murder as a crime against humanity related to the EJK during his leadership’s drug war.

His good friend, former senator Manny Villar, reacted to his arrest and expressed his sadness over Duterte’s prosecution. He was sad that he had to face the trial under an international tribunal instead of being given the chance to defend himself in the country.

“It was my hope that former President Rodrigo Duterte would have the opportunity to defend himself in our courts under the protection of our country’s rule of law,” Villar said.

He had defended Filipinos overseas, hence his sadness at seeing a good friend of his in a similar situation. Despite this, he is confident that his friend will exhaust all legal avenues to defend and protect himself before the international tribunal.

He hopes that he will be given a fair trial.
